Three Portuguese business school courses make FT list

 In Business, News

Three Portuguese business schools have made the 2018 Financial Times executive MBA list.

The Nova School of Business and Economics (Nova SBE) takes the best classification from among Portuguese business management courses, coming internationally at 57th place.
The second best was Católica Lisbon School of Business and Porto Business School which also keep their place among the 80 best business schools in the world.
ISCTE which had been in the ranking is no longer included in the 2018 league table.
The Nova SBE has retained its place at 57 for the third year running. It improved its position by 10 places in the ranking for courses designed for companies, moving up from 62nd place to 52nd place to overtake Católica Lisbon School of Business in this category.
The Católica Lisbon School of Business is the second best school for training business executives overall, having fallen 13 places to 63rd position in the world ranking.
Porto Business School has gone from 69th place to 76th place from among the 80 best business schools in the world but improved its ranking for customised company management courses from 75th place to 64th place.
